Find News & Information businesses in Discovery Centre.

Entertainment & Media: News & Information, Discovery Centre

Yellow Pages Canada supplies comprehensive contact information for News & Information businesses within our Entertainment & Media category in and near the Discovery Centre, Ontario area. Find the best News & Information businesses near Discovery Centre. With Yellow Pages you’re sure to find the right business the first time, every time.

Close menu